Maple Sugar Cake.

Cream one-half cupful of butter with two cupfuls of sugar until well mixed. Beat and stir in alternately one cupful of milk and two and one-half cupfuls of flour sifted with three teaspoonfuls of baking powder and onehalf teaspoonful of Balt Then cut and fold in the whites of five eggs beaten to a dry stiff froth. Bake in three layers until done and put together with maple filling made as follows: Cook three cupfuls of maple sugar with one-half cupful of water until it threads when dropped from the tines of a fork. Beat the syrup into the of two eggs beaten until stiff luid dry. When the filling is stiff enough to spread put it between tbe layers and on top of the cake.
